lu.ma events MCP server. Create events, set ticket prices, issue coupon codes, list RSVPs, and email attendees. All writes go through draft+confirm so nothing posts to Luma until you explicitly approve. Built on the official Luma public API.
## What it does
- Create + update lu.ma events (name, date, timezone, capacity, meeting URL, visibility, cover image)
- Set ticket types and pricing
- Issue coupon codes (calendar-scoped or event-scoped, percentage or fixed-cents discounts, redemption caps)
- List event guests / RSVPs
- Send markdown emails to attendees (pre-work, day-of, follow-up)
- Audit log of every API call (JSONL with key/token redaction)
- Prompt-injection scrubber on user-supplied free-text fields
## Tools (v0.1.0)
Reads (call API directly):
- `luma_health` — auth check + draft store size
- `luma_get_event` — fetch one event by ID
- `luma_list_events` — paginated calendar listing
- `luma_list_event_guests` — RSVPs filtered by status
- `luma_list_coupons` — calendar or event-scoped
Writes (draft+confirm pairs):
- `luma_create_event_draft` / `luma_create_event_confirm`
- `luma_update_event_draft` / `luma_update_event_confirm`
- `luma_create_ticket_type_draft` / `luma_create_ticket_type_confirm`
- `luma_create_coupon_draft` / `luma_create_coupon_confirm`
- `luma_send_event_email_draft` / `luma_send_event_email_confirm`
Plus:
- `luma_cancel_draft` — cancel an unconfirmed draft (idempotent)
14 tools total.

## Safety patterns
1. **Draft + confirm on every write.** The draft tool returns a `draft_id`; nothing hits Luma until the matching confirm tool is called. Drafts expire after 1 hour and can only be confirmed once.
2. **Audit log.** Every API call is logged JSONL with `ts`, `tool`, `action`, args (redacted), `status`, `latency_ms`. Path: `~/.claude/luma-mcp/audit.log`.
3. **Token redaction.** Strings matching long-key heuristics, or values under keys like `api_key`, `token`, `cookie`, `secret`, are masked before logging.
4. **Prompt-injection scrubber.** User-supplied free-text fields (event name, description, email subject, email body) are passed through `unicodedata.normalize("NFKC")`, stripped of zero-width characters, and have role-spoof prefixes / fake fences wrapped in backticks (preserving operator visibility, neutralizing model effect on downstream reads).
5. **Zero LLM in the tool path.** Every routing decision is rule-based.
## Use cases
- **Workshops + paid events** — set sticker price, issue community-specific 100%-off coupons, pull guest list, blast pre-work email.
- **Multi-event programs** — one cohorte announcement, sub-events on Luma, pull RSVPs across sessions.
- **Recurring meetups** — duplicate event template via update_event_draft, change date, ship.
## Install
Open Claude Code, paste:
/plugin marketplace add adelaidasofia/luma-mcp
/plugin install luma-mcp@luma-mcp
Two prerequisites for the server to authenticate:
1. **Luma Plus subscription** on the calendar you'll use (the public API is gated behind Plus).
2. **API key** generated from `https://lu.ma/settings/api`, dropped into `~/.claude/luma-mcp/.env` as `LUMA_API_KEY=...`.
After both steps, restart Claude Code. Tools appear under `mcp__luma__*`.

## Rate limit
Luma's public API caps at 200 requests / minute / calendar. The client does not auto-retry on 429; it surfaces the error and lets the operator pace.

## Telemetry
This plugin sends a single anonymous install signal to `myceliumai.co` the first time it loads in a Claude Code session on a given machine.
**What is sent:**
- Plugin name (e.g. `slack-mcp`)
- Plugin version (e.g. `0.1.0`)
**What is NOT sent:**
- No user identifiers, names, emails, tokens, or API keys
- No file paths, message content, or anything from your work
- No IP address is stored after dedup processing
**Why:** Helps the maintainer know which plugins people actually install, so attention goes to the ones that get used.
**Opt out:** Set the environment variable `MYCELIUM_NO_PING=1` before launching Claude Code. The hook will skip the network call entirely. Already-pinged installs leave a sentinel at `~/.mycelium/onboarded-<plugin>` — delete it if you want to reset state.
